The future will be increasingly distributed. As the publicity surrounding Bitcoin and blockchain has shown, distributed technology and business models are gaining popularity. Yet the disruptive potential of this technology is often obscured by hype and misconception. This detailed guide distills the complex, fast moving ideas behind blockchain into an easily digestible reference manual, showing what's really going on under the hood.

Finance and technology pros will learn how a blockchain works as they explore the evolution and current state of the technology, including the functions of cryptocurrencies and smart contracts. This book is for anyone evaluating whether to invest time in the cryptocurrency and blockchain industry. Go beyond buzzwords and see what the technology really has to offer.

Learn why Bitcoin was fundamentally important in blockchain's birth
Explore altcoin and alternative blockchain projects to understand what's possible
Understand the challenges of scaling and forking a blockchain
Learn what Ethereum and other blockchains offer
Examine emerging business uses for blockchain beyond cryptocurrency
Discover where the future lies in this exciting new technology

Lorne Lantz has been educating the world on blockchain, including German bankers at TedX Hamburg. Lorne is an O'Reilly blockchain expert, producing educational videos on the blockchain. He was technical reviewer for "Mastering Bitcoin" and co-chair of the O'Reilly Bitcoin & Blockchain conference. Lorne has built blockchain stacks including remittances, crypto wallets, POS, forex, crypto trading and ICO investing. Daniel Cawrey first became involved with blockchain technology as Contributing Editor for CoinDesk, the largest information resource for the blockchain and digital currency industry. He co-wrote the Velocity whitepaper, a decentralized derivatives concept for the Ethereum blockchain. He is CEO Pactum Capital, a financial services firm focused on market making and liquidity technologies.
